Hi Eddie,
Method will sync with the default sales tax settings from QBO. Can you make sure that your QBO is set correctly and perform a full sync? A full sync is needed to have Method set the default sales tax. A changes only sync will not trigger this.

You can certainly delete a customer or lead. If they are a customer in both QB and Method, this will delete them in both places. I should also mention that you can merge customers in Quickbooks, and by doing that, they will also merge in Method, moving all of the links to that customer as well.
